What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1910.178(p)(1): Powered industrial truck(s) found to be in need of repair, defective, or in any way unsafe had not been  taken out of service until restored to safe operating condition(s)  a) On or about 05/21/2014 in the company's second warehouse, a Combi-lift vehicle did not have a horn in working condition.

29 CFR 1910.157(c)(4): Portable fire extinguishers were not maintained in a fully charged and operable condition  a) On or about 05/21/2014 in warehouse#2 (Steve's warehouse), a portable fire extinguisher was partially discharged.
